The average salary for a financial quantitative analyst in New York is around $107,490 per year.
Avg Salary
Financial quantitative analysts earn an average yearly salary of $107,490.
Wages typically start from $55,370 and go up to $230,770.

How do financial quantitative analyst salaries compare to similar careers?
Financial quantitative analysts earn about the same as related careers in New York. On average, they make less than investment fund managers but more than business analysts.
